Output 221bb2d736e11826439a4dbbaa4be30726a9419a988c39ddaf0a70e8c5b7a5b3:123

value
149595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a770d09bae24142eb7a51bc2484890640fddd10 OP_EQUAL
address
3BPxAgUSwUDGLezK2jLXYLg5UJCEjeFier
transaction
221bb2d736e11826439a4dbbaa4be30726a9419a988c39ddaf0a70e8c5b7a5b3
spent
true